Hi experts,

Can u tell me the importance of the transaction SPRO.

And also about Roles And Profiels.

SPRO stands for SAP Project Reference Object. It is used to configure the setting as per your client requirement by using the standard setting present in the system. This where you can do all the SAP configuration work.

IMG :- Implementation Guide.

SPRO :- SAP Project Reference Object.

SPRO------>IMG.

Type in the T-Code SPRO under That got to Main Menu which is IMG.

SPRO is basically used to organize the consultant customizing during the SAP Project Phrase

SPRO stands for SAP Project Reference Object. It is used to configure the setting as

per your client requirement by using the standard setting present in the system.

This where you can do all the SAP configuration work.

Entering SPRO (Customizing: Execute Project) as a transaction code in the R/3 application

opens the customizing environment.

There you can customize the R/3 system using the SAP reference IMG (Implementation Management Guide)

or you can define projects for customization: e.g. adapting the reference IMG to the needs

of your company and/or subdivide the customization task into different sub projects.

SPRO is the customizing transaction in SAP R/3. This transaction can be configured.
